Career Guidance Skills communication, collaboration and creativity S1.6 - promoting, selling and purchasing S1.6.0 - promoting, selling and purchasing Make bids in forward auctions
Description
Create and provide forward bids, taking into account possible special requirements such as refrigeration of goods or transport of potentially hazardous materials.
